Effect of nursery nutrient management on yield and economics of Swarna and Swarna-Sub 1 in submergence prone ecosystem of eastern Uttar Pradesh

Abstract

A field experiment was conducted at Crop Research Station (NDUAT), Masodha, Faizabad during kharif 2011 & 2012 to access the effect of nursery nutrient management on yield and attributing traits of Swarna and Swarna Sub-1 in submergence/flood prone ecosystem of eastern Uttar Pradesh. The experiment was comprised of seven different nutrient combinations viz. T1 - N100:P50:K0 kg/ha, T2 - N60:P40:K­40 kg/ha, T3 - N20:P40:K40 kg/ha, T4-N20:P40:K60 kg/ha, T5 - N20:P60:K40 kg/ha, T6 - N0:P60:K40 kg/ha and T7-N0:P40:K60 kg/ha in nursery plots. Highest grain yield of rice (38.28 q/ha) during 2011 and (38.46 q/ha) during 2012 was obtained under variety Swarna Sub1 with nursery nutrient treatment T4- N20P40K60. The economic analysis also exhibits profitability of this treatment combination (T4- N20P40K60) over the other treatments with submergence tolerant rice variety Swarna Sub-1. Maximum benefit: cost ratio of 1.79 and 1.83 during both respective years was recorded under combination of variety Swarna Sub1 and T4- N20P40K60 nutrient treatments.
